7 ways to double your health by soaking your feet

7 ways to double your health by soaking your feet

There is a saying: Soaking your feet in hot water is better than eating ginseng. Although there is some exaggeration, it can be seen that foot soaking has great benefits to the body. As the weather turns cooler in autumn, the human body's blood circulation slows down, and the feet, which are farthest from the heart, are more susceptible to "cold". At this time, soaking your feet in hot water can not only improve blood circulation and promote metabolism, but also reduce inflammation, kill bacteria and moisturize the skin. The feet are the part of the human body that is farthest from the heart. As the weather turns cooler in autumn, the blood vessels in the feet contract, blood circulation is disrupted, and a variety of diseases can be easily induced. Soaking your feet in hot water before going to bed can improve local blood circulation, drive away the cold, promote metabolism, and ultimately achieve the purpose of health care. If you add some "ingredients" to the foot bathing water, it can have the effects of killing bacteria and disinfecting, promoting qi and blood circulation, and softening the skin of the feet.

Salt water foot bath

When soaking your feet in hot water, you can add two spoons of salt. After the salt dissolves, you can soak your feet. Salt water has the effect of disinfection and sterilization. Therefore, soaking your feet in salt water can effectively prevent athlete's foot. In addition, salt water exfoliation and ordinary hot water can further remove old cuticles on the basis of softening them, gradually improving the rough and thick texture of the feet and making the foot skin soft and smooth again. Not only that, soaking your feet in salt water can also warm your body and prevent colds.

Drinking water foot bath

Alcohol has a certain stimulating effect on the skin, which can dilate capillaries and promote blood circulation. Therefore, when soaking your feet in hot water, adding an appropriate amount of rice wine or other alcoholic beverages can further enhance blood circulation, promote qi and blood circulation, and is beneficial to your health. In addition, alcohol also has a certain disinfecting and bactericidal effect, and soaking your feet in alcohol can also remove foot odor.

Vinegar foot soak

Vinegar has a strong bactericidal effect. Adding vinegar to water and soaking your feet is very effective in treating athlete's foot. In addition, vinegar is stimulating to the skin and can promote blood vessel dilation. The nutrients in vinegar can penetrate into the skin, circulate through the blood, remove blood waste, and have a good preventive effect on some chronic diseases. Finally, soaking your feet in vinegar water can soften the skin of your feet. Doing so in the long run can make your feet more tender.

Ginger foot bath

Ginger is warm in nature and has the effect of strengthening the stomach and dispelling cold. Soaking your feet in hot water soaked with ginger can promote blood circulation, warm the spleen and stomach, remove dampness and drive away cold, and it also has a certain effect on preventing colds. In addition, ginger can significantly inhibit skin fungi. Therefore, soaking your feet in precipitation can also remove athlete's foot and give you healthy feet.

Mugwort Foot Bath

Take 50-100 grams of dried moxa leaves (depending on the amount of water, there is no strict standard), boil them with water and then add cold water or wait for the temperature to lower before soaking your feet. If you find it troublesome, soak the moxa leaves in part of the hot water for 20 minutes and then add water to soak your feet. Mugwort and ginger can cure colds, joint diseases, rheumatoid arthritis, coughs, bronchitis, emphysema and asthma. Mugwort and safflower can improve varicose veins, peripheral neuritis, poor blood circulation, numbness or blood stasis in the hands and feet.

Almond Tea Recipe

45g bitter almonds, 10g green tea. Put the above medicines into the pot, add 2000 ml of water, boil for 30 minutes, remove the residue and take the juice. Take 1 small bottle of liquid and apply it to the face and arms. Pour the remaining liquid into a basin and soak your feet for 30 minutes when the temperature is suitable. It can moisturize the skin, reduce inflammation and kill bacteria, supplement vitamins and minerals, and prevent and treat skin sallowness, dullness, roughness, acne, and scabies.

Pepper water foot bath

Grab a handful of peppercorns, wrap them in gauze, put them in a pot and boil water, then fumigate your feet first, and then start soaking your feet when the water temperature is suitable. Sichuan pepper water has a good sterilization effect and can prevent foot odor, foot sweat and athlete's foot.
